Today I stopped at a local health food store to pick up a few things. I saw their display of soaps and went to check them out. There was a display of soaps that had cigar bands on them. I picked up the Lemongrass one and it barely smelled of lemongrass. Then I picked up one that was called Ginger Berry. I didn't smell ginger or berry. In fact the bar didn't smell good AT ALL! It had what I thought was a rancid smell to it. Does CP soap go rancid? I've haven't had a bar of soap in my house for very long (give 'em out to family and friends almost as soon as they're made). What can be done, if anything, to keep the soap from smelling bad?

Sure, soap can go rancid. Use the freshest oils and butters possible and keep away from moisture or excessive heat (unless in the bathroom). Some people add a small % of ROE (Rosemary Oleoresin Extract) to their oils as soon as they get them.

My mother and grandmother both made soaps. I have my mother's soap here that is about 20 years old. It has faded and there is no scent left, but it makes for a fine soap. Light, heat and humidity wreak havoc on handmade soaps. I don't use vit E in soaps. I feel that due to the high pH of lye, the lye eats it. I don't use ROE either, but I live in a dry desert.
